APIC Mode (Enabled)
This item allows you to enable or disable the APIC (Advanced Programmable Interrupt
Controller) mode. APIC provides symmetric multi-processing (SMP) for systems,
allowing support for up to 60 processors.
1st/2nd/3rd Boot Device (Hard Drive/Pioneer DVD-ROM ATA/1st FLOPPY
DRIVE)
Use these items to determine the device order the computer uses to look for an operating
system to load at start-up time.

Boot Other Boot Device (Yes)
When enabled, the system searches all other possible locations for operating system if it
fails to find one in the devices specified under the First, Second, and Third boot devices.
